The coincidence of the Centenary of Granados’ death in 2016 and the 150th Anniversary of his birth in 2017 provides a unique opportunity to re-discover and re-evaluate the important contributions by Granados to the musical world and to highlight the ties between his native Catalonia and the city of New York.
An international committee is now actively working to organize and coordinate events commemorating the Granados Centenary around the world.
The centenary celebrations are being sponsored by the Foundation for Iberian Music, at the Graduate Center of the City University of New York.
